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Putney Bridge Station to Elephant & Castle Station is to drive which costs £1 - £2 and takes 19 min.
The fastest way to get from Putney Bridge Station to Elephant & Castle Station is to taxi which takes 19 min and costs £55 - £70.
No, there is no direct bus from Putney Bridge Station station to Elephant & Castle Station station. However, there are services departing from Putney Bridge Station / Gonville Street and arriving at Elephant & Castle Station via Haymarket / Charles II Street.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 19m.
Yes, there is a direct ferry departing from Putney Pier and arriving at Vauxhall St George Wharf Pier. Services depart every 30 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 39 min.
The distance between Putney Bridge Station and Elephant & Castle Station is 7 miles. The road distance is 5.8 miles.
The best way to get from Putney Bridge Station to Elephant & Castle Station without a car is to subway and line 148 bus which takes 40 min and costs £6 - £18.
It takes approximately 40 min to get from Putney Bridge Station to Elephant & Castle Station, including transfers.
Putney Bridge Station to Elephant & Castle Station bus services, operated by Go Ahead London, depart from Putney Bridge Station / Gonville Street.
Putney Bridge Station to Elephant & Castle Station bus services, operated by Go Ahead London, arrive at Trocadero / Haymarket station.
Yes, the driving distance between Putney Bridge Station to Elephant & Castle Station is 6 miles. It takes approximately 19 min to drive from Putney Bridge Station to Elephant & Castle Station.
What companies run services between Putney Bridge Station, England and Elephant & Castle Station, Greater London, England?
Uber Boat by Thames Clippers operates a ferry from Putney Pier to Vauxhall St George Wharf Pier every 30 minutes, and the journey takes 39 min.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Putney Bridge Station / Gonville Street to Elephant & Castle Station via Trocadero / Haymarket and Haymarket / Charles II Street in around 1h 19m.
